If you just get the TM, you will miss the following components:  Stem Close-up (where one of the 30 stems is presented with a list of words that use that stem and their definition.   I just realized that we always skipped it because it's only in the student book so I didn't know it was there  :glare: ), Sentences (each of the 30 stems used in a word in a sentence), the Analogies won't be doable (the TM only has the answers), and the Classic Words won't be doable (the TM only  has the answers).  So you are missing about half of the exercises if you only get the TM.  Is that worth it for half the cost?
